Abstract or Summary

Ramp Gallery is a contemporary public art gallery situated in the heart of Hamilton city. Ramp runs a curated programme of exhibitions showing work from New Zealand and International artists. The 2014 exhibition programme included 8 exhibition projects and multiple public programme events. Highlighted curatorial projects within the 2014 programme include Small Press co-curated by Kim Paton and Bryce Galloway and What's the Hurry co-curated by Kim Paton and Mark Harvey. Public programme events included live performances by Phil Dadson, Enrique Siques, Rob Thorne and Kraus.
